Shopify vs WooCommerce vs Magento: Choosing the Best eCommerce Platform for Your Dropshipping Store in 2025
Explore Shopify vs WooCommerce vs Magento for your dropshipping store in 2025. Compare ease, cost, SEO, and scalability to choose the best eCommerce platform.

Choosing the best eCommerce platform is such an important decision for starting a successful dropshipping business. Shopify vs WooCommerce vs Magento all command the eCommerce world, offering different benefits for your business needs based on the consideration of easy of use to scalability. Whether you're a beginner or seasoned entrepreneur it's important to know the strengths and weaknesses of these three platforms before launching a successful dropshipping store. In this comprehensive guide we're going to compare Shopify vs WooCommerce vs Magento so you can decide which platform is the best for your dropshipping business in 2025. Let's take a look at important things to consider!
What Makes Shopify, WooCommerce, and Magento Different?
Interested in the differences between Shopify vs WooCommerce vs Magento? These are all top eCommerce platforms with various distinctions you should be aware of before you start dropshipping:
Shopify: A cloud-hosted platform that launched in 2004, Shopify hosts just over 4.7 million online stores. Shopify is known for its ease of use with multi-functional apps to save you time, automated or assisted hosting, and limitless theme options making it a favorable choice for novice dropshippers.
WooCommerce: An open-source WordPress plugin that costs nothing, WooCommerce supports over 6.2 million websites. As an open-source app WooCommerce offers lots of flexibility and customization potential perfect for the dropshipping entrepreneur who has WordPress experience and wants to keep costs as low as possible for other apps.
Magento (Adobe Commerce): Acquired by Adobe in 2018, Magento is an open-source platform designed for large-scale operations. Magento is full detailed features, is among the most scalable eCommerce platforms available, and can include sophisticated features to deploy unrelated of Magento, but the complexity is not ideal for drop shippers with small businesses.
All three platforms support dropshipping but their approaches significantly differ in complexity of platform and function. Each has its features, and in order to make the best choice for your online store, you need to understand them and what each one offers.
Which Is the Easiest Ecommerce Site for Dropshipping?
It's important to understand the concept of ease of use, especially if you're a new entrepreneur:
Shopify: Shopify has the easiest process of any of the sites above. It is an all-in-one web hosting and is easy to use with a drag-and-drop interface and editable templates. You don't have to have coding skills to set up a dropshipping store with Shopify. You can launch a dropshipping store with Shopify in a matter of hours with the help of apps like Oberlo (with a free plan), Spocket, and Printful to easily import products and fulfill orders, making Shopify the best option for beginners.
WooCommerce: WooCommerce is an open-source WordPress plugin. That means you are responsible for setting up a website, web hosting, selecting a domain, and getting various plugins, which can be intimidating for beginners. Nevertheless, while the setup process for WooCommerce is long and tricky, the dashboard is relatively easy to navigate, and it offers various dropshipping plugins (e.g., AliDropship or WooDropship) that will help streamline your dropshipping process for WordPress users.
Magento: Setting up Magento can be a complicated process that may require a developer to set up hosting, themes, extensions, and configuration. Once you have Magento set up and you pay for the dropshipping extension ($249) you will have to customize it, and allow for the learning curve, so it is not beginner friendly, but it is more suitable for high-volume, complex dropshipping operations.
Overall, Shopify wins the battle for launching your dropshipping store fastest, followed by WooCommerce if you already feel comfortable with WordPress, and Magento is suitable for advanced users.
How Much Will Shopify, WooCommerce, and Magento Cost You for Dropshipping?
Cost is a primary consideration in the Shopify vs WooCommerce vs Magento comparison:
Shopify: Costs range from $19 to $299 for a monthly plan (billed annually). Its Basic plan ($19) has typical dropshipping tools, however, additional costs easily spiral out of control with transaction fees (if you use any third-party gateway, you pay 2.9% + 30¢, with Shopify Payments there are no transaction fees if they're supported in your country) and apps (Oberlo's premium plans will cost around $60 a month). If you'd like to be able to provide a premium theme, it'd cost anywhere between $100 and $350 (one-time) depending on how much premium content you want.
WooCommerce: You can download it for free, but again you'll still have ongoing costs: hosting ($5-$25/month), a domain name ($4-$20/year), and plugins/themes that you'll probably have to pay for ($25-$199 each). For dropshipping, his plugin and others, like AliDropship was a low one-time fee of $89; WooDropship charges $49/year. Fee to use payment gateways (i.e. with WooPayments, the cost would be 2.9% + 30¢). This is why I'll consider WooCommerce to be the least expensive.
Magento: same as Shopify, there is a free open-source version, but you would need hosting ($20-$100/month), and like any specialized sites, developers for set up and long term support. Extensions, like dropshipping for Magento will cost $249 (one-time), unless you needed to customize Magento for your store(s), then it'd get expensive, otherwise it will most likely end up being your most expensive option for dropshipping.
WooCommerce probably has the lowest upfront cost of the three sites; Shopify at least has a predictable model, and you could probably tailor it to your budget; Magento is better suited for brands with high budgets and big, dropshipping store ambitions.
Which Platform Provides the Most Features for Dropshipping?
If you're wondering how to compare dropshipping capabilities in Shopify vs WooCommerce vs Magento, each platform has ways to manage and operate a dropshipping business.
Shopify: Shopify has many compatible dropshipping apps including Oberlo and Printify. These apps automate everything from adding products to managing inventory and fulfilling orders. Shopify has a free plan with Oberlo which is easy to set up, plus it has other features like low-stock alerts to make dropshipping easier.
WooCommerce: Since WooCommerce is open-source, it is flexible and customizable way to setup woocommerce. WooCommerce can work with dropshipping plugins like AliDropship, WooDropship, DropshipMe, etc. to automate adding the products and order fulfillment. Also, through the WordPress plug-in library, you can create a variety of your dropshipping workflow, such as multi-vendor marketplace.
Magento: Magento offers a dropship extension for $249 with more creative possibilities working with shops that have an extensive number of products and inventories. The extended designed information may not be very realistic for small and medium-sized dropshipping websites since the service would require massive and/or extensive developer support.
Overall, Shopify and WooCommerce are the best platforms for building your dropshipping business since their apps are easy to use and integrate. The complexity of Magento makes it best suited for certain advanced use cases (i.e., complex, high-volume operations).
How Does Shopify, WooCommerce, and Magento Affect SEO for Dropshipping?
Want to know how Shopify vs WooCommerce vs Magento affect the visibility of your dropshipping store? SEO drives organic traffic and is an important part of driving success:
Shopify: Shopify provides some built-in SEO functionality, including user customizable titles, meta descriptions, and URLs. Shopify is a cloud-based application, so it has clean code and fast load times that will help improve SEO. However, if you want advanced SEO features, then you would need to pay for apps ($19+/month). Immediately, Shopify limits your customization options.
WooCommerce: WooCommerce is built on WordPress. This allows the use of many basic and advanced SEO plugins like Yoast SEO (free or premium) to optimize your dropshipping website. WooCommerce allows you to fully control your meta data, content, and structure. As a result, SEO for dropshipping is very favourable when using WooCommerce.
Magento: Magento allows for SEO features, including editable metadata, customizable sitemaps, canonical tags, etc.. Compared to the other platforms, Magento gives you the most advanced and customizable features. Note: Because Magento is an opensource platform, you can customize it however you want and optimize it to the max, but there is a technical and setup cost to opening a site. Magento is best with large dropshipping stores with SEO teams.
Overall, WooCommerce comes out on top for most flexibility and control, Magento comes second for advanced / tech users. Shopify is behind but is good enough and offers great basics but limits modification and customization.
What is the most scalable platform for dropshipping stores?
If you're planning to grow your dropshipping business, scalability is the measure of a platform's ability to handle increased traffic and increase inventory.
Shopify is the easiest to scale, with unlimited bandwidth and over 6,000 apps. Shopify supports an unlimited amount of large inventories and a lot of traffic. Shopify provides features like automated inventory alerts when approaching limits. Higher-tier plans ($79 to $299 a month) or Shopify Plus plans ($2,300+ a month) help you prepare for future dropshipping demands.
WooCommerce scales fairly well for small to medium dropshipping stores when optimized hosting is utilized, such as WP Engine or Kinsta. WooCommerce is flexible and allows for many custom integrations but optimizations are impacted by hosting performance and plugins.
Lastly, Magento is the most scalable solution, it is designed for dropshipping stores with a complex product catalog and large amount of traffic. Magento 2 updates with enhanced performance are now available! However, scalability is dependent on quality hosting and developer support.
When it comes to dropshipping, Magento is great for enterprises with large-scale dropshipping needs, Shopify is good for businesses that are increasing in size, and WooCommerce would be best suited for small to medium-sized dropshipping stores who have quality hosting.
How Secure Are Shopify, WooCommerce, and Magento for Dropshipping?
Are you worried about securing your dropshipping store? Security is important when it comes to customer data for dropshipping:
Shopify: Shopify provides SSL certificates, PCI-DSS compliance and fraud detection; so your dropshipping payments are secure. Shopify is a hosted platform , so it will take care of security updates and protect you as the user.
WooCommerce: WooCommerce relies totally on the security of WordPress; which means that you have to buy your own SSL certificate, make sure your hosting service is secure, secure and update your plugins, and more. You can also use security plugins like Wordfence to secure your site; however it is still totally reliant on you to set up an active management programme.
Magento: Magento provides great security , however it requires a dedicated technical team and development resources to ensure that security compliance is maintained. Magento has regular patch updates and vulnerability assessments to ensure PCI-DSS compliance. There are also a variety of extensions to ensure threat detection.
In conclusion, Shopify has the lowest portfolio of user responsibility to ensure security. WooCommerce requires the most proactive management in generating security. Magento requires any business to have on going technical resources with their hosting.
Frequently Asked Questions About Shopify vs WooCommerce vs Magento for Dropshipping
Still have questions about Shopify vs WooCommerce vs Magento for your dropshipping store? Here are answers to common queries:
Q: Which platform is best for dropshipping beginners?
Shopify is the easiest due to its all-in-one setup and dropshipping apps like Oberlo. WooCommerce suits WordPress users, while Magento is too complex for novices.
Q: Which platform is the most cost-effective for dropshipping?
WooCommerce is the cheapest with free software and affordable dropshipping plugins, though hosting costs apply. Shopify starts at $19/month, while Magento involves high setup costs.
Q: Which platform has the best dropshipping integrations?
Shopify and WooCommerce lead with dropshipping integrations (e.g., Oberlo, AliDropship). Shopify is streamlined, while WooCommerce offers customization. Magento’s integrations are costlier.
Q: Which platform is best for SEO in dropshipping?
WooCommerce excels with WordPress SEO plugins, followed by Magento for advanced users. Shopify’s SEO is sufficient but less flexible.
Q: Can these platforms scale for large dropshipping stores?
Magento is the most scalable, followed by Shopify for growing stores. WooCommerce scales well with optimized hosting but may face limitations for massive stores.
Conclusion
In summary, choosing between Shopify vs WooCommerce vs Magento for your dropshipping store in 2025 depends on your business size, budget, and technical skills. Shopify offers simplicity and robust dropshipping integrations, perfect for beginners and growing businesses. WooCommerce provides flexibility and low costs, ideal for WordPress users and small to medium dropshipping stores. Magento delivers unmatched scalability for large-scale dropshipping operations but requires technical expertise. Assess your needs, weigh the pros and cons, and select the platform that fuels your dropshipping success!
What's Your Reaction?






